Web27 mei 2024 · Clear any objects off the deck and sweep to remove dust, dirt, and debris. After sweeping, use a paint scraper to remove any paint that is still on the deck. Run the scraper over areas with flaking, chipped, or peeling paint. WebThe best ways to remove mildew from a wood deck are: Use a paste of oxygen bleach and water to scrub away mildew. Rent a pressure washer to scour mildew from your deck. Use a commercial moss, mildew, mold, and algae remover. Make a cleaning solution from water and laundry detergent. Use trisodium phosphate mixed with water to create a powerful ...

WebCommon Methods of Removing Paint from a Deck You can remove paint chemically with paint strippers or mechanically by scraping, power washing, and sanding your deck. Deck-maintenance pros prefer chemical strippers and power washers because they’re …

Attach a wide spray tip to the end of the spray gun. Keep the end of the spray gun at least 18 inches away from the deck to avoid gouging the wood. Be sure to clean between the boards. Paint can be applied to water sealers, but the drying time of the sealer itself is the most important part of this task.For best results, prime the water-sealed wood first.
